Set in the 1980s before the age of smart phones, computers and the internet, 24 year old diarist Nicholas narrates the difficulties, tragedies, failed relationships and intellectual obsessions that continually torment him.
But then he meets some people who are much worse off than himself.

Author, singer-songwriter, dreamer, drifter, environmental campaigner and house-husband Peter G. Brown, after being unable to publish his first novel in the 1980s due to the closed attitude of the publishing industry, decided to self-publish his second novel Strings with Xlibris. He has also released seven albums (see www.lemang.com) and spawned three (now grown-up) kids, and currently lives in Malaysia with his osteopath wife, musical partner and mother of 2 of the kids Markiza.
